Specifications
With a calendar function
±100 ppm, excluding a delay (of 1 second, maximum) caused each time the power is turned on.
The date/time for switching between standard time and DST can be specified.
A built-in lithium battery backs up the setup parameters and runs the clock
(battery life: approximately ten years at room temperature).
Password for releasing the key lock can be set.
RCD key, MENU key, DISP MENU key, FEED key, and function under the FUNC key (Alarm ACK,
computation start/stop, print, message, printout buffer clear, periodic printout reset, and pen or
ribbon cassette exchange, data saving start/stop, data replay start/stop, SD memory card ejection)
Lights up the recording area of the chart paper. Uses a dedicated LED.
Machine Noise Information Ordinance 3.GSGV, Jan 18, 1991
Maximum noise level: 60 dB (A) or less (complies with ISO7779)
